otter/__init__.py,sha256=sLbIR9KVyAqTsgcZ11SMOMXznne0E0TCO4Ks9Il1UNQ,217
otter/__main__.py,sha256=krRYmQSQ823dKEfmhnFdJTVonTiWC7t0yXg20UvMeOY,93
otter/argparser.py,sha256=KUkfe1tvjjM0iqfgqrCs7xIv97lta32uW16uc5Pq2Ys,16087
otter/assign.py,sha256=e3umdtaDRKJFbPbXfCaxxYuAzpTWAAiLZoO4PuI0O1Y,33070
otter/check.py,sha256=x-cbyOug_Ew8rQxKEr_INneddN8zBXZTm-VTerzigWk,2872
otter/containers.py,sha256=VMWTDhAXyUTzlyRGHFoZW0Jr2UQxr6acQkVOLkPvlZ8,13737
otter/execute.py,sha256=Og4TUbhZu7G73GP6rNUypSTVjlQdFTsRQvqCA3pp1QQ,29750
otter/grade.py,sha256=CEwi67DUitTRe-cLYH6f1FqcIivqA4d4_yFVtB3E3Xw,3310
otter/jassign.py,sha256=5tmgt-nrWV214NK8nK9Tu3qUWvBTpWf3KGeCxYqqerM,16720
otter/logs.py,sha256=pjjzDmk4LCaNois4Z4_D8ap_ZM1IDih5ZHZpi6rXNWs,17676
otter/metadata.py,sha256=S0ifq7ANxW73bzGCPSrUOZreMHrvYgkzQA1_a8QaDtQ,9708
otter/notebook.py,sha256=rIQi5iIZ8KCR32kEPMSMi8Mpascj4DY-nBwYZ43TwBc,18346
otter/ok_parser.py,sha256=rC44W7VAEbtHlWJ7cq-uOA8uzzlXBE4x9Xq0ywkZLWg,17177
otter/run.py,sha256=OpZGmlnesGY4Lu3q1JKoVUdi0rLp__GFON2FQGtOZNs,1680
otter/utils.py,sha256=CD4ouPLJzKVg4WMEeE4W2FbNM24oNfxAK_oLOEII9O8,3852
otter/version.py,sha256=bx0QPcq6Xt6E-zonzeTAn81JfdeXUWHVF-A9gt8dtZY,893
otter/assign/__init__.py,sha256=olafpGga6aLbR_8bL9fltovOz6axy3td8b6WMaj-S8w,4826
otter/assign/assignment.py,sha256=HtHMHCu5QSyUw_XEaMhiS4Ejn2OzVFAXEFYGgNO_UpQ,3879
otter/assign/cell_generators.py,sha256=lrhWypjAXKcT5deSxTrcOJox9BMadH8M0IJMl7Uy2lQ,5264
otter/assign/constants.py,sha256=TWhubvLrtLkq1jmEddCIJsgUWxok2YxBhDLrUwJ9gq4,731
otter/assign/notebook_transformer.py,sha256=G1LM59Bs3X6n0_kx8HfG1ohwMEvi0awliinGLE_RBrE,8270
otter/assign/output.py,sha256=MsWNjjV65oJG3wLILrUWI6iNTjdM1zBUgUOWUu7bdck,5099
otter/assign/questions.py,sha256=QtshnuucOmusIn-u7SSIkXH6NxAhbuapJQ3HOcRQMXk,2300
otter/assign/solutions.py,sha256=iSbmW6-IOn5FBbFRQ6uIm2t7no3aIhdPF834QFX26qk,3410
otter/assign/tests.py,sha256=QDzIn1m0__BJaMAuMqqjg70Np_DYUgKIZgO26Or9MHk,5217
otter/assign/utils.py,sha256=7j77d6KVBnj2E33HJ-N9NZIir-Xsv49IVmvW1ul_fwY,9670
otter/assign/r_adapter/__init__.py,sha256=47DEQpj8HBSa-_TImW-5JCeuQeRkm5NMpJWZG3hSuFU,0
otter/assign/r_adapter/tests.py,sha256=SeVw6-CUYB2oAJUhJACtf1_BWB9NauUur0jaD0fm_S8,5639
otter/assign/rmarkdown_adapter/__init__.py,sha256=47DEQpj8HBSa-_TImW-5JCeuQeRkm5NMpJWZG3hSuFU,0
otter/assign/rmarkdown_adapter/constants.py,sha256=-SfdHjO_EVoqUlG8qsnW4DjBzCtNt3hurTjTdVBdVoQ,101
otter/assign/rmarkdown_adapter/notebook_transformer.py,sha256=CR_JuYvZ4Os1z2gfqBi3yaMCfctWrKr3fbiuFTEl1tM,8579
otter/assign/rmarkdown_adapter/output.py,sha256=ZOx-miT4YR8GanoT-ZdFLBxyKZ1ntylYZ5I9TZex6Qo,5438
otter/assign/rmarkdown_adapter/solutions.py,sha256=1I4wK7nc4ugsgUVGtn6B7EoLJ_RWr8uA8tlAUGjBI0o,3835
otter/assign/rmarkdown_adapter/tests.py,sha256=fHplAy27O-hWWVwMOC5cjos3OEhL2VJL2O8F6aYN4Ro,1880
otter/assign/rmarkdown_adapter/utils.py,sha256=yirDp8KGQ3CSwZCGyh3rGi009WmYFgHxTqNZNecmg1E,2962
otter/check/__init__.py,sha256=GwMDtcaN31YqCx0okS-5ijCRPgd_Yo5mXYpQ1_HaUZM,2782
otter/check/logs.py,sha256=BpB6lt5mlns6ThDo9P2I0dtIxRrXQ8Z4E0A_j95st7g,17932
otter/check/notebook.py,sha256=kHyeOaHNXf9VBVi-CqsvHS2PfqXNt0AMrZdSIWFctow,16791
otter/execute/__init__.py,sha256=dgBAduzhQZupO1v5F2_wQwXpfZQX13ityoVlcQ25IWM,5104
otter/execute/check_wrapper.py,sha256=DPz1YGtDf6be66b7Uew4Qvu36isxS-WjRA_dv2SrqJg,5024
otter/execute/execute_log.py,sha256=bn8IeXK787duNZc1EMlQ80Tz9I7zIk31kUtGKEaVPNo,4189
otter/execute/execute_notebook.py,sha256=2-fO1gqWDwJnpQnozSre_ZuQfGM_jjKGOX9QeNmVmY0,7619
otter/execute/execute_script.py,sha256=VZeEmI13veDjWB34W2QqNQjSRo2dOFdzaNIAaNn-6gI,3733
otter/execute/results.py,sha256=B29pu0OOmsjBTeXeOkLOFp4WSH_7-kuqfPfmDOct32E,9775
otter/export/__init__.py,sha256=hDRKHrtu7jXq_ylQNkLJZSubP-1QsrEYka_qqxVk_08,1575
otter/export/filter.py,sha256=QF1x7izNsL-ZnENBbUcxwLUo6y3VeYOs74KpEbECmQo,5539
otter/export/test.tplx,sha256=Un0zhB-aXGBxjLZMbaQciu93OtgPCPHxiGdM4MrmLlY,894
otter/export/exporters/__init__.py,sha256=9RXOmuB9g4AR7H6vAyAgJgyXIdk2rRfUaJ7Xmw5VpQY,1326
otter/export/exporters/base_exporter.py,sha256=AeIy5WxsSYiZy9lIFHaVC7f22Y9Z7EiqB6CUImEBPuo,5257
otter/export/exporters/utils.py,sha256=syU4Pk4vbd44FoDWuWsB5sybOGH6BKWkm3kcJbi7dxQ,2922
otter/export/exporters/via_html.py,sha256=LDO8r9DpZa5YBBe9nTsj-8aKvRhcGIzot8c6TAqK3zo,2355
otter/export/exporters/via_latex.py,sha256=euiBhTRKeNBDzFnXeWoWa0CQqESS-QDua2abQoGPoW4,2443
otter/export/exporters/templates/via_html.tpl,sha256=gI6qjvjEcHY5-dJEa8IfTPErGsplLp7mSyObqUSkbZk,780
otter/export/exporters/templates/via_latex.tpl,sha256=Un0zhB-aXGBxjLZMbaQciu93OtgPCPHxiGdM4MrmLlY,894
otter/generate/__init__.py,sha256=qB12ta2K6ZILdUJtXqJCntOlKrUktFFG9ead0MI_QzE,90
otter/generate/autograder.py,sha256=Ad_vNt2nw5LUApiyu0pOP3BkRSAjNcpV21_paYhIGtM,7356
otter/generate/constants.py,sha256=VK_n49x9bb1zKWhJigfgdawaO9cP329R93PtRdo_6fU,628
otter/generate/run_autograder.py,sha256=2TjCMtUJKKSikRpQKEQap6aogDx_fBE1CzkLg0CV7Ko,7423
otter/generate/token.py,sha256=kSu02wgpEt1L5W50hkRCE-Agcl4IDL87PrV3TceDikc,3599
otter/generate/utils.py,sha256=86OdUoQiNycmU7geWKwLYr1aV4YTi1c9ClVLy-vDQ0s,1259
otter/generate/run_autograder/__init__.py,sha256=-18Sjuh52uik4c7r3DkVsU6tQ2ezSV73yo_qD19xZ10,861
otter/generate/run_autograder/run_autograder.py,sha256=YkrFescMCZ8ATSe6UG0cCjRyc36xF0oY40550teRKZQ,4345
otter/generate/run_autograder/r_adapter/__init__.py,sha256=47DEQpj8HBSa-_TImW-5JCeuQeRkm5NMpJWZG3hSuFU,0
otter/generate/run_autograder/r_adapter/run_autograder.py,sha256=8sWFCOBBbSF7ieHK05bHRIwpJbpuwp7e-z8loONrvB0,1648
otter/generate/templates/environment.yml,sha256=y_CWUgYV550sLTqrfC6hCJjbpp8evyCDT7fVRFNv4TQ,203
otter/generate/templates/requirements.r,sha256=b7HqI-BQhFVau3YhpUKNVjXsN6X1hAtb92Hg43asl_M,217
otter/generate/templates/requirements.txt,sha256=fAFys2wj3d3_xPEJRvJA3tf9v0VQpF-TCkvMPc2-D00,297
otter/generate/templates/run_autograder,sha256=RHIDaYukPnNEXVYrHPKZfwXRdsb7c2tfu0e2IuSxSXc,193
otter/generate/templates/run_otter.py,sha256=akGhF1LdAuxMepITzc7ehSqzeSdKvlU72DKmzGqHH_k,901
otter/generate/templates/setup.sh,sha256=HO-NlnzD2dgm9aZO5Si_c6zZc73SMz9GAV32J_918S0,1920
otter/grade/__init__.py,sha256=nJCiMc_mspWvnS8sGj6LhEh6ZvVfohopIQUvl6E1JoI,3600
otter/grade/__main__.py,sha256=iGgsIcU5UXFlKP-gH4F0kpqzMNV8RgfEjovZzffZCPQ,6526
otter/grade/containers.py,sha256=EKU7Kq8DIOPElUmoqUm0u8S9n4lhaiF8ADjqD_b3rMk,11715
otter/grade/metadata.py,sha256=MZTXBdrJYTBe3JHEua3D6crixGEAUq_6LjKsp9U97i8,9611
otter/grade/utils.py,sha256=-EIleVqS8S952iUXmW4DPIWQLeWZ1_i22beVTZ1wTmU,3020
otter/service/__init__.py,sha256=pDY8k9TBNgT2uHbCxzJ6AmcSiUEgqVFINlzHrb521U4,179
otter/service/build.py,sha256=wxuV9LYeaAYKsVmTn1pGQNtiGlyuBp7Zo4Ho7FXnV1c,6285
otter/service/create.py,sha256=rKei8UkL2zqwsHYPoB_zV9H-d3TV6OFuptC-PfSeVGc,5581
otter/service/start.py,sha256=4PPCge-VwP1DQOb91yIFIqxliRS7vfFSCdVHLYc3mTU,17036
otter/service/utils.py,sha256=hDSMOkfMwsre3R7vNXU1_r12Vni1UFoTIJRjc_sB0pY,1006
otter/service/templates/api_key.html,sha256=mx71qEC1nD0w5JdXsNR24RwnBPe-zj11gtvob5S5geY,1207
otter/test_files/__init__.py,sha256=ZNUb9Eq9AnrHPkyVXHX5EwG7tpHYXyNroTn9vqExoXM,119
otter/test_files/abstract_test.py,sha256=pY-kp7Yx29-K8NDFcrsr5F-KDrFboeTza6kbMXDnvLI,6265
otter/test_files/ok_test.py,sha256=H5DD2pHo6lbMtIH6IhGAWKJ5VmaUBAVGtCgdHWu5qG0,5153
otter_grader-1.1.2.data/scripts/otter,sha256=E2nFGlouXEb-t34SsZwc-lbTZ4Gw-wvKLWbA_jRnHE8,86
test/__init__.py,sha256=47DEQpj8HBSa-_TImW-5JCeuQeRkm5NMpJWZG3hSuFU,0
test/__main__.py,sha256=diFElVYm7BoHodDtH4TSBcGbJ4UBaFi1BjC4Phka4Lc,728
test/test_assign.py,sha256=nCnIph7Pac1RIxK2n-bh2ByMLDqgNwTlRJOW6pVCN5I,6349
test/test_check.py,sha256=wOSoBtLr3_lBX5JKg4LP7SWcZhAjPr-nLxs8Gr77e90,6890
test/test_export.py,sha256=LIZ_elzwEr_qOLGfDViFswb6lxjVau2ZKPCCx6SaNhc,5371
test/test_grade.py,sha256=BOi0jPJgZE8Gu2ahi1DtfZg4uC1gPSMQvDKAfOVLBOo,11882
test/test_logs.py,sha256=3ORs22jGEwe0R9p9r0IHkkSso5HYKnHBau4YBkPE3sE,518
test/test_execute/__init__.py,sha256=47DEQpj8HBSa-_TImW-5JCeuQeRkm5NMpJWZG3hSuFU,0
test/test_execute/test_results.py,sha256=ylVhf58x50p90nmDH2TQhkdJ0ma7PFJAtijN5RX5o8U,4155
test/test_generate/__init__.py,sha256=Qux6iVsFTHen-0Q6zxhy64mD63XJB1dMUOUzdhLVLsc,99
test/test_generate/test_autograder.py,sha256=cyMvlmalSYa1ZKv6A0vhiiK-EAq1JJBJrjcOlbeL7g8,3917
test/test_generate/test_run_autograder.py,sha256=kp-5tLeiFghKAJBrqf9B4VPPSSMd-kSxGZTbfvb-upk,2457
test/test_generate/test_token.py,sha256=D2Wt6Bb5FnoONbvT68ZrQ7EZppvCPQAQdA8XqY1CzGw,2949
test/test_generate/test-run-autograder/__init__.py,sha256=47DEQpj8HBSa-_TImW-5JCeuQeRkm5NMpJWZG3hSuFU,0
test/test_generate/test-run-autograder/autograder-correct/__init__.py,sha256=47DEQpj8HBSa-_TImW-5JCeuQeRkm5NMpJWZG3hSuFU,0
test/test_generate/test-run-autograder/autograder-correct/submission/__init__.py,sha256=47DEQpj8HBSa-_TImW-5JCeuQeRkm5NMpJWZG3hSuFU,0
test/test_service/__init__.py,sha256=EDU1WaWqQYRccktusrq9Zp8cp2i0sSm8QYaApepYBbc,96
test/test_service/test_build.py,sha256=_VAcVySUpuO0WmE9Am56asveR1p2il8I804gGYY0LxM,2565
test/test_service/test_create.py,sha256=JJqYYRlKxralsT-_9-Zr0ju2ceRdIzgi1vjFfYDknoE,3861
test/test_service/test_start.py,sha256=2YK9XfYxYRbpgbJA-uEJRIgg5ieUph7o0VkkqpXQX-A,15926
otter_grader-1.1.2.dist-info/LICENSE,sha256=avID1BoB3wjOvxdBCRJzEFRK5PXze2p_aW0oezjThY4,1560
otter_grader-1.1.2.dist-info/METADATA,sha256=yDnNqNFMscurIDz0gvOFMRoGdefN1m_B8T9djWiJCuc,3220
otter_grader-1.1.2.dist-info/WHEEL,sha256=g4nMs7d-Xl9-xC9XovUrsDHGXt-FT0E17Yqo92DEfvY,92
otter_grader-1.1.2.dist-info/top_level.txt,sha256=3KLhpHO76mXGklGf_XS-C-6cyucz1i-jLpdlAZ9Yqys,11
otter_grader-1.1.2.dist-info/RECORD,,
